Industry Insights: The Shift to Browser-Accessible Games
Historically, digital adaptations of tabletop games relied heavily on dedicated software or downloadable apps, which often imposed barriers related to device compatibility and installation complexities. Recent developments, however, highlight a notable pivot towards browser-based solutions that eliminate friction and foster inclusivity. According to recent reports by the Game Developers Conference (GDC), approximately 65% of new digital game launches in 2023 leverage web technologies such as HTML5, WebGL, and WebRTC to facilitate in-browser gameplay.
| Key Advantages of Browser-Based Gaming | Impact on Player Engagement & Industry Growth |
|---|---|
| Accessibility: Play from any device with an internet connection, no downloads required. | Increases user acquisition, particularly among casual players and mobile users. |
| Real-Time Interactivity: Instant multiplayer sessions powered by WebRTC and similar tech. | Enhances user retention through dynamic, competitive experiences. |
| Cross-Platform Compatibility: Seamless play across desktops, tablets, and smartphones. | Broadened market reach, supporting inclusive communities around game content. |

Integrating New Technologies for Dynamic Gameplay
The next phase involves sophisticated integrations of emerging technologies such as WebAssembly, cloud computing, and AI-driven matchmaking algorithms. These advancements enable complex game logic to run smoothly within the browser, ensuring smooth, real-time interactions even in multiplayer environments with large participant pools.
For instance, browser-based digital casino games, strategy platforms, and card games are increasingly responsive and secure, with server-side stability ensuring fair and consistent gameplay. Developers are also leveraging these capabilities to innovate in areas like augmented and virtual reality, further blurring the lines between physical and digital experiences.
